JUST A SCAR HIDDEN IN THE EYELID
We use cutting-edge techniques to perform a blepharoplasty that produces a single scar, which is hidden in the fold of the upper eyelid .
In the lower eyelids, it can be performed inside the conjunctiva (transconjunctival) without leaving any scars on the skin.
In all cases it is performed with local anesthetic and sedation, with the patient able to go to his home after the procedure . The patient can resume their normal routine within a week.
